WHAT’S THE JOB?
Support QCI & Hygiene Manager and Hotels’ Operations Teams to drive and improve overall guest experience and hotel quality compliance. Quality compliance that includes the highest level of sanitation and hygiene standards in the hotel; ensure all food served to guests and employees are free of microbiological, chemical and physical contamination and all work areas conform to minimum requirement set by local health authorities, HACCP / ISO.
YOUR DAY-TO-DAY
Administers HACCP policies and procedures within the hotel
Monthly food safety training / refresher for existing and new colleagues with report
Establish standards in Food and personal hygiene, sanitizing / disinfection procedures are in place (work with stewarding)
Part of the Hygiene committee to review any issue pending to hygiene with meeting and minutes recorded
Bimonthly audit based on Food safety polices with a report to Executive Chef with addressing corrective action required
Monthly Laboratory report for food items
Ensure HACCP system is implemented and maintained in accordance with all the procedures and work instructions established
Initiate action to prevent the occurrence and recurrence of any non-conformances relating to the product, processes and the HACCP system
Random / spot checks at F&B outlets cleanliness of work stations or any pest-related issues
Be aware of duty of care and adhere to occupational, health and safety legislation, policies and procedures and initiate action to correct any hazardous situation.
Be familiar with property safety, first aid, fire and emergency procedure and operate equipment safely and sensibly
Part of Halal committee to ensure that Halal certification and documentation in the Hotel are maintained and renewed on a yearly basis.
Work with the leadership team to lead the Continuous Improvement process and culture within the hotel
Retrieve, analyze and disseminate information from IHG’s Quality tools such as Medallia, Tableau and other sources of information.
Assist in the submissions of all IHG Brand Standards related documentations on a timely basis as required.
Assist in the monthly Quality-meeting for Hotel Operational departments
Supports in implementation of Brand Standards and preparations for Yearly Brand Audit and Mystery Shopper Program (or equivalent) for Hotel.
Oversees for all Social Reviews and guest feedback to be responded in a timely manner.
Coordinate with Department Heads and Hotels’ Training and Compliance Manager to promote and support functional alignment around brand standards
Monitor implementation of Brand Safety Standards with Engineering to ensure consistent understanding of risk management due dates on risk management calendar and annual compliance
Create actionable reporting, leveraging Guest Experience and Quality systems to inform decisions around quality compliance, improved guest experience and standards compliance
